TO THE CONGRESS OF THE UNITED STATES:

In accordance with the resolution of advice and consent to ratification of the Convention on the Prohibition of the Development, Production, Stockpiling and Use of Chemical Weapons and on Their Destruction, adopted by the Senate of the United States on April 24, 1997, I hereby certify in connection with Condition (7)(C)(i), Effectiveness of Australia Group, that:

          Australia Group members continue to maintain an equally 
       effective or more comprehensive control over the export of 
       toxic chemicals and their precursors, dual-use processing 
       equipment, human, animal and plant pathogens and toxins with 
       potential biological weapons application, and dual-use 
       biological equipment, as that afforded by the Australia Group 
       as of April 25, 1997; and

          The Australia Group remains a viable mechanism for limiting 
       the spread of chemical and biological weapons-related materials 
       and technology, and that the effectiveness of the Australia 
       Group has not been undermined by changes in membership, lack of 
       compliance with common export controls and nonproliferation 
       measures, or the weakening of common controls and 
       nonproliferation measures, in force as of April 25, 1997.

WILLIAM J. CLINTON
